As a small business owner, managing and tracking expenses can be a daunting task. However, with the rise of best business credit cards, small businesses now have access to a powerful tool that can not only help them streamline their financial processes but also provide a host of other benefits.

Here are some of the positive benefits of best business credit cards for small businesses:

1. Improved Cash Flow Management

With a business credit card, small businesses can easily track their expenses and manage their cash flow more effectively. Business owners can set credit limits for each employee, making it easier to monitor and control company spending. Additionally, most business credit cards provide detailed monthly statements, making it easier for businesses to track and categorize expenses.

2. Rewards and Perks

The best business credit cards offer rewards and perks that can benefit small businesses. These rewards can come in the form of cashback, travel rewards, or discounts on office supplies and other business-related expenses. By using a business credit card for everyday purchases, small businesses can accumulate rewards that can then be used to reinvest in the business or as a source of additional income.

3. Building Business Credit

Just like individuals, businesses also have credit scores that can affect their ability to secure financing and other important financial transactions. By using a business credit card responsibly, small businesses can build a positive credit history and improve their credit score. This can then make it easier for them to access loans, lines of credit, and other types of financing in the future.

4. Separate Personal and Business Expenses

One of the biggest benefits of business credit cards is the ability to keep personal and business expenses separate. This can save business owners time and headaches when it comes to filing taxes and tracking business expenses. By using a business credit card for business-related purchases, small business owners can easily distinguish between personal and business expenses and avoid any confusion or mix-ups.

5. Purchase Protection and Insurance

Many business credit cards come with purchase protection and insurance that can protect small businesses in case of theft, loss, or damage to items purchased with the card. This can be particularly helpful for businesses that regularly make large purchases or travel for business purposes. The added protection can provide peace of mind and save businesses from unexpected financial losses.

6. Simplified Bookkeeping

Small businesses often have limited resources and manpower, making it challenging to keep up with bookkeeping and accounting tasks. However, by using a business credit card, most of the financial data is tracked and recorded automatically, making it easier for business owners to reconcile expenses and simplify bookkeeping processes.

7. Access to Higher Credit Limits

With a business credit card, small businesses can access higher credit limits than personal credit cards. This can be particularly helpful for businesses that have high operational costs or need to make large purchases to keep their operations running smoothly. Having a higher credit limit can also provide a safety net in case of unexpected expenses or emergencies.
